Ear wax removal in Neston

Earwax is good for the health of your ears and it plays a vital role in preventing infection and removing debris from the ear canal. However, some people produce more than others, making them prone to a build-up over time that can become hard and impacted, leading to irritation, hearing loss, or infection, if not removed. If you find yourself struggling to hear conversations, especially in background noise, or frequently ask people to repeat themselves, it might be a sign of hearing loss. Amplify Hearing offer a free hearing test to help you determine if you could benefit from hearing aids.

Our hearing tests are painless and take about 30 minutes. A registered audiologist will ask you about your hearing history and then conduct a series of tests to measure your hearing ability at different pitches. Based on the results, the audiologist will discuss your options and answer any questions you may have.
